Systems Engineer Jobs in Washington DC: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ies sponsor visas for systems engineers in Washington DC?

Defense contractors and government IT firms are the most active sponsors in the DC area. Booz Allen Hamilton, Leidos, SAIC, General Dynamics IT, Peraton, and Northrop Grumman all have documented H-1B sponsorship histories for systems engineer roles. Large federal technology integrators tend to have established immigration support processes, though sponsorship availability varies by contract type and security clearance requirements.

Which visa types are most common for systems engineer roles in Washington DC?

The H-1B is the most common visa category for systems engineers in DC, as the role typically q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ring a relevant bachelor's degree or higher. Candidates from Canada and Mexico may also qualify under the TN visa for engineers. Some employers in DC also sponsor EB-2 or EB-3 immigrant visas for longer-term placements, particularly within government contracting firms.

Which areas in Washington DC have the most systems engineer sponsorship jobs?

Most systems engineer sponsorship activity in the DC metro is concentrated in Northern Virginia, particularly Tysons Corner, Reston, and Arlington, where many defense contractors and federal IT firms maintain large offices. Bethesda and Rockville in Maryland also have notable concentrations, driven by federal agencies and health IT contractors. The District itself hosts fewer private-sector engineering employers but has government-adjacent opportunities.

Are there any Washington DC-specific considerations for systems engineers seeking visa sponsorship?

Security clearance requirements are a significant factor unique to the DC market. Many systems engineer roles at federal contractors require or prefer candidates with an active security clearance, which is generally not accessible to foreign nationals without permanent resident status. International candidates should focus on commercial and civilian-facing roles within larger contractors, or positions explicitly noted as not requiring clearance, to maximize sponsorship eligibility.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ored systems engineer jobs in Washington DC?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
